Training Overview

Training Overview

Planning effective research strategies is vital for departments and colleges seeking to boost their research reputation and attract external funding. The Developing Scientific Research Plans for Departments and Colleges training course is designed to empower academic leaders and faculty coordinators with the knowledge and tools to create focused, strategic research plans. Participants will explore how to set research priorities, define measurable outcomes, identify potential partnerships, and manage resources to support long-term research success.

What are the goals?

By the end of this training course, participants will be able to:

  • Build a structured research vision and mission
  • Conduct SWOT and gap analyses for departmental research
  • Develop strategic and operational research plans
  • Align research activities with national/institutional priorities
  • Establish monitoring and evaluation frameworks

The Course Content

Day One: Strategic Context of Research Planning
  • Importance of research in academic excellence
  • National and international research priorities
  • Role of leadership in research culture
Day Two: Assessing Research Capabilities and Needs
  • SWOT analysis of departmental research
  • Gap analysis in faculty skills and resources
  • Identifying thematic research areas
Day Three: Formulating Research Goals and Objectives
  • Defining SMART objectives
  • Setting long-term research targets
  • Building interdisciplinary research agendas
Day Four: Operationalizing the Research Plan
  • Timeline development and milestones
  • Budgeting and resource allocation
  • Collaborations and grant opportunities
Day Five: Monitoring, Evaluation, and Continuous Improvement
  • Research KPIs and performance indicators
  • Reporting and feedback systems
  • Review and update mechanisms
